Problems solved by technology

[0003] Hand-held grinding tools are mainly operated manually, with low grinding efficiency and unstable grinding quality. In addition, manual grinding is labor-intensive and poses occupational hazards;
[0004] The flexibility and scalability of the special grinding machine is not high, and it can only be developed according to the product requirements; most of the special grinding machines are used for deburring and polishing of hardware parts, and cannot polish welds with large differences in position and size;
[0005] The working efficiency of constant force flange welding seam grinding device is low, and only one tool can be used to finish and polish the weld seam at a time, and most of this type of device is used for polishing, deburring and putty grinding

Abstract

The invention relates to a double-spindle type weld joint grinding device. The device comprises a weld joint detecting and positioning device, a grinding device body, a polishing device and a base plate, wherein the grinding device body and the polishing device are connected with the base plate through guide rails correspondingly, a constant force control device used for driving the grinding device body and the polishing device to move in the axial direction is installed on the base plate, and the weld joint detecting and positioning device is fixed to the base plate through a connecting pieceand is parallel to the base plate. The grinding device is reasonable in design and high in automation degree, through arrangement of the grinding device body, the polishing device and the constant force control device, the grinding efficiency is remarkably improved, the grinding quality is effectively improved, and the grinding application space is obviously increased.

Description

Technical field [0001] The invention relates to the field of machinery, in particular to cutting technology, in particular to a double-spindle type weld grinding device. Background technique [0002] Welding seam grinding devices are mainly divided into handheld grinding tools, special grinding machines and constant force flange welding seam grinding devices; among them, handheld grinding tools are mostly used for manual grinding and polishing operations; special grinding machines are mainly used for grinding and deburring hardware parts ; Constant force flange welding seam grinding device is integrated on the robot, which is the expansion of the robot application. [0003] Hand-held grinding tools are mainly operated manually, with low grinding efficiency and unstable grinding quality.
